As someone who is passionate about fitness and regularly uses my Peloton bike, I was excited to try out the Peloton Heart Rate Band.

I found the device to be incredibly comfortable to wear, with its stretchy knit fabric and grippy material that prevented it from slipping off my arm during workouts.

The Velcro fastener also made it easy to tighten and remove the band, and I appreciated the fact that it came in both small and large sizes to accommodate different users.

Versatility

What really impressed me about the Peloton Heart Rate Band was its versatility.

The device uses Bluetooth to connect with any Peloton machine and display your heart rate on the screen. It also works with third-party gym equipment and apps in addition to Peloton’s own, which makes it incredibly versatile.

I was able to use the Peloton Heart Rate Band with the MYX II smart stationary bike, the NordicTrack Vault workout mirror, the Ergatta rowing machine, and the Tempo mobile app, among others. This means that no matter what type of workout I was doing, I could always track my heart rate and adjust my intensity level as needed.

Testing

During my testing, I found the Peloton Heart Rate Band to be incredibly accurate, providing consistent heart rate readings throughout my workouts. In fact, I noticed that the readings were consistently about 5 bpm lower than other devices I’ve used, which was actually a relief because it made me feel like I was working a little less hard than I thought!

The LED lights on the front of the band were also a great feature, providing real-time feedback on my heart rate zone during workouts. The lights corresponded to Peloton’s Strive Score metric, which helped me to track my progress and adjust my intensity level as needed.

One thing that really stood out to me about the Peloton Heart Rate Band was its ease of use.

To set up the device, all I had to do was plug it into the charger and place the pod on top to wake it up.

When all five LEDs on the band shone blue, I knew that it was fully charged and ready to use.

Once charged, I could easily snap the pod into the armband and fasten it around my forearm.

When I logged into my Peloton machine, the Heart Rate Band paired automatically, making it incredibly convenient to use.

Battery

In terms of battery life, the Peloton Heart Rate Band offered up to 10 hours of use on a single charge, which was more than enough for several workouts in between charges.

While this is not as long as some competitors, such as the Wahoo Tickr Fit, which promises 35 hours of battery life on a charge, it is still a respectable amount of time.
